Amplifier Features Noise Figure of 0.55 dB


Mini-Circuits unveils its ultra-low noise ZX60-0916LN+ amplifier that has a noise figure of 0.55 dB while delivering 18 dB gain and a high output power of up to 16.5 dBm. Reliable and packaged in a rugged Unibody housing and using SMA connectors, these amplifiers can be used in a range of applications from 824 MHz to 960 MHz, including CDMA: 824 to 894 MHz, GSM Rx: 880 to 915 MHz and GSM Tx: 925 to 960 MHz. These 5 V amplifiers are available from stock.
